Chinese Snowball Tree | Buy Potted Plants
top of page

The Chinese snowball tree is a top choice for landscaping enthusiasts looking to enhance their outdoor spaces. With its stunning large white blooms, this shrub adds a touch of elegance and beauty to any garden or yard. What sets it apart is its ability to retain its blossoms for an extended period during the springtime, ensuring a longer-lasting display of natural beauty. (USDA Zones 5-8)

Chinese Snowball Tree

$89.95Price

    Best Sellers

    Potted Chestnut Trees

    bottom of page